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
The phrase "a vast region"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to describe a large geographical area or expanse, often in a context related to geography, nature, or exploration. Example: "The explorers ventured into a vast region of uncharted territory, eager to discover new landscapes."

Phrases that express similar concepts, ordered by semantic similarity:
an expansive area
Emphasizes the extent and openness of the area.
a large territory
Highlights the area's status as a defined or controlled space.
a wide expanse
Focuses on the breadth and openness of the area.
an extensive zone
Implies a specific area designated for a particular purpose or characteristic.
a broad swathe
Suggests a wide strip or area, often with a uniform characteristic.
a sizable domain
Highlights the area's significant size and potential control or influence.
a considerable tract
Emphasizes the area's substantial size and often refers to land.
an immense stretch
Focuses on the unbroken length and vastness of the area.
a sweeping landscape
Highlights the visual grandeur and broad scope of the area's scenery.
a boundless realm
Implies limitless extent and often refers to a kingdom or sphere of influence.
FAQs
How can I use "a vast region" in a sentence?
Use "a vast region" to describe a large geographical area or territory. For example, "The explorers charted "a vast region" of unexplored wilderness".
What can I say instead of "a vast region"?
You can use alternatives like "an expansive area", "a large territory", or "a wide expanse" depending on the context.
Is it redundant to say "a vast geographical region"?
While not strictly redundant, "geographical" is often implied when using ""a vast region"". You can omit "geographical" unless you need to emphasize the geographical aspect.
What's the difference between "a vast region" and "a large area"?
"A vast region" suggests a greater scale and often implies a sense of remoteness or significance, whereas "a large area" is a more general term for size.
